(CNA reporter Lin Qiaolian, Kaohsiung, 5th) Ruan General Hospital recently passed the greenhouse gas inventory verification. The hospital stated that it will continue to deepen carbon management and sustainable governance, balancing the quality of medical care with environmental responsibility to create a more patient-friendly environment.

Ruan General Hospital announced yesterday that it had passed the "ISO 14064-1:2018 Greenhouse Gas Inventory Verification." At the certification ceremony, it was noted that this achievement is an important milestone for the hospital in promoting environmental sustainability and net-zero transformation. Representatives from the verification body, Arsis International Certification Co., Ltd., were also present to witness the event.

Ruan General Hospital stated that it was founded in 1946 and has been providing local medical services in the Kaohsiung area for nearly 80 years. Facing global climate change and the trend towards net-zero emissions, medical institutions not only bear the responsibility of protecting public health but must also actively respond to environmental sustainability issues.

The hospital pointed out that medical institutions are high-energy-consumption facilities, with major carbon emission sources including air conditioning systems, lighting equipment, and electricity for medical instruments. Therefore, promoting greenhouse gas inventory is like conducting a health check-up for the hospital. By taking stock of energy use and carbon emission sources, it serves as an important basis for subsequent carbon reduction and sustainable governance.

The hospital stated that passing the ISO 14064-1:2018 greenhouse gas inventory verification not only signifies that the hospital's efforts in environmental management and sustainable development have received international standard recognition but also lays the foundation for future carbon reduction strategies and net-zero transformation. In July of this year, it will launch the "ISO 14067 Carbon Footprint Project" to further inventory carbon emission information throughout the lifecycle of medical services and deepen carbon management capabilities.

The hospital indicated that it will continue to move towards the goal of "balancing health care and environmental sustainability." Through institutionalized carbon management and carbon reduction strategies, it hopes not only to provide the public with high-quality medical services but also to create a more environmentally friendly and safe medical environment, becoming an important model for promoting sustainable medical development in the Kaohsiung area.
